#385f81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#385f81 is composed of 22% red, 37.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 26.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 36.3%. #385f81 color hex could be obtained by blending #70beff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#385f81 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#385f81 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#385f81 has RGB values of R:56, G:95,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3694465.

Shades and Tints of #385f81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f7f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#385f81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5d5d is the less saturated color, while #0662b3 is the most saturated one.
